Right question 1) Mines a 1999 VTS on a V which is the year they Phase2 was launched and as far as I know as long as you check the dates when ordering and make sure its a VTS manifold your ordering your be ok

Question 2) All VTS's have the cat under the car only the late VTR's ie Phase2's had the cat in the manifold so see the answer to question 1

Question 3) The best value for money airfilter on the market which also offers good gains is the RaceLand enclosed Scoop filter with the upgrade to the Green filter inside

Question 4) RaceLand are imported items from europe and are fine, linked with the items you hqave mentioned you should see a nice little gain
